The highly anticipated Betway Premiership clash between Kaizer Chiefs and Magesi FC, originally scheduled for Wednesday, 26 November 2025, at Seshego Stadium, has been officially postponed. This news comes directly from Kaizer Chiefs, who confirmed the postponement via their social media channels.
Why the Postponement?
The reason behind this scheduling change is Kaizer Chiefs' ongoing commitments in the CAF Confederation Cup. Amakhosi are currently competing in the group stage of the tournament and have a crucial match against Egyptian giants Zamalek looming on Saturday, 29 November, at the Peter Mokaba Stadium in Polokwane.
Chiefs are looking to bounce back after a narrow 2-1 defeat to Al Masry in their opening group stage match. A strong performance against Zamalek is vital to their continental campaign.

Magesi FC's Perspective
For Magesi FC, this postponement adds another twist to their season. Currently sitting in 14th place in the Betway Premiership, they are fighting to avoid relegation. This match against Kaizer Chiefs was seen as a crucial opportunity to gain valuable points.
Magesi FC, under coach John Maduka, will need to regroup and prepare for their next challenge, whenever that may be. Their recent form has been inconsistent, and they will be looking to improve their scoring record.
